Turquoise, Blue, Purple Ziploc Bag Smoosh Mani



I'm so glad this week is finally almost over! It feels like such a long week, coming back after a brief vacation. Today I have another Ziploc bag smoosh mani. I was originally planning to stamp over this but once I applied top coat I ended up liking it too much on it's own to cover!

I started with a white base (Layla No. 23) and then for the marble I used Color Club Blue-Ming, Color Club Yahoo Purple, and Essie Make Some Noise.

Here's my right hand which ended up a bit darker, with more purple and blue. Which do you prefer?



This technique is fairly easy and I love how each nail turns out differently :) You basically put dots of polish on your nail (over a base color), cover with a piece of ziploc bag (I prefer the thick freezer bags but you can use any plastic), and then gently squish the polish around. I also slide the plastic around a bit... just be careful not to over mix it or your nail will look muddled. Here's a video tutorial!
